Clinical effectiveness of different lung collapse optimisation strategies during one-lung ventilation in thoracoscopic surgery

Conditions

Lung cancer

Interventions

group A:preemptive one lung ventilation combined with disconnection technique
group B:preemptive one lung ventilation combined with negative pressure suction
group C:disconnection technique combined with negative pressure suction

Inclusion criteria

Inclusion criteria: 1. patients undergoing thoracoscopy elective left lung segment or lobectomy surgery under elective general anesthesia; 2. ASA grade ?~?; 3. Age 18~64 years old; 4. BMI 18.5~27.9 kg/m^2; 5.Patients were willing to be tested and signed an informed consent form.

Exclusion criteria

Exclusion criteria: 1. Preoperative pulmonary function tests: FEV1 <70%; 2. Patients with severe cardiopulmonary, hepatic and renal dysfunction; 3. History of thoracic surgery; 4. History of tuberculosis, pleurisy, pneumothorax and severe COPD; 5. Patients who refuse clinical trials.

Design outcomes

Primary

MeasureTime frame
Time of complete lung collapse;

Secondary

MeasureTime frame
lung collapse score;PaO2;postoperative pulmonary complications;Incidence of hypoxaemia;
